diff --git a/backend/builder/service.py b/backend/builder/service.py index b7e0fe7..9fc128b 100644 --- a/backend/builder/service.py +++ b/backend/builder/service.py @@ -20,7 +20,7 @@ def _ensure_storage_dir(): def _binary_url(melody_id: str) -> str: """Returns the API URL to download the binary for a given melody id.""" - return f"/api/builder/melodies/{melody_id}/download" + return f"/builder/melodies/{melody_id}/download" def _row_to_built_melody(row: dict) -> BuiltMelodyInDB: diff --git a/frontend/src/melodies/builder/BuilderForm.jsx b/frontend/src/melodies/builder/BuilderForm.jsx index f845697..15c36c2 100644 --- a/frontend/src/melodies/builder/BuilderForm.jsx +++ b/frontend/src/melodies/builder/BuilderForm.jsx @@ -131,7 +131,7 @@ export default function BuilderForm() { ← Back to Builder
Build binary (.bsm) files and firmware PROGMEM code from melody step notation. @@ -62,7 +62,7 @@ export default function BuilderList() { className="px-4 py-2 text-sm rounded-md transition-colors" style={{ backgroundColor: "var(--btn-primary)", color: "var(--text-white)" }} > - + Add Melody + + Add Archetype